Output 306abf42f77fea436e4867a97a00bd4468d8982a5c3b863111d060e737fb10ff:0

value
21718879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1861ce1babf2bab85f2fad8931c574c83636a161 OP_EQUALVERIFY OP_CHECKSIG
address
13DvPDt7Na2fRV867g1BAbBpzySfHj7FNs
transaction
306abf42f77fea436e4867a97a00bd4468d8982a5c3b863111d060e737fb10ff
spent
true